One of the most unique and memorable experiences in Cape Town is swimming with the sharks. Yes, you read that right! Shark cage diving is a thrilling activity that allows brave adventurers to get up close and personal with one of the ocean’s most feared predators. With an experienced guide, visitors can venture into the waters of False Bay or Gansbaai to encounter great white sharks firsthand. It’s an awe-inspiring experience that will give you a newfound appreciation for these magnificent creatures.

If you’re looking to explore the city’s vibrant culture, a visit to the Bo-Kaap neighborhood is a must. Known for its brightly colored houses and cobblestone streets, this historically significant area is home to the Cape Malay community. Take a walking tour to learn about the neighborhood’s rich history, cultural traditions, and sample some authentic Cape Malay cuisine. The Cape Malay people are known for their warm hospitality, and this immersive experience will leave you with a deeper understanding of Cape Town’s diverse population.

For wine enthusiasts, a visit to the Cape Winelands is a dream come true. Just a short drive from Cape Town, this picturesque region is home to some of the world’s finest vineyards and wineries. Rent a car or join a guided tour to explore the scenic towns of Stellenbosch, Franschhoek, and Paarl. Visit award-winning wineries, indulge in wine tastings, and savor delicious gourmet meals paired with the perfect glass of vino. The Cape Winelands offer a tranquil escape from the hustle and bustle of the city, and the picturesque landscape is the perfect backdrop for wine lovers to relax and unwind.

If you’re an adrenaline junkie, Cape Town has something for you too. How about abseiling down Table Mountain? This exhilarating activity allows thrill-seekers to descend 112 meters down the sheer cliffs of the iconic mountain. With breathtaking views of the city below, it’s a heart-pounding adventure that will give you a whole new perspective on Cape Town’s natural wonders.

For nature lovers, a visit to Boulders Beach is a must. Known for its resident penguin colony, this idyllic beach is home to over 2,000 African penguins. Visitors can stroll along the boardwalks, spot penguins nesting in the sand, and even take a dip in the crystal-clear waters alongside these adorable creatures. It’s a unique and unforgettable wildlife encounter that will leave you in awe of nature’s wonders.
